Subject: [PATCH v8 8/9] selftests: ublk: add stress test for per io daemons
Add a new test_stress_06 for the per io daemons feature. This is just a
copy of test_stress_01 with the per_io_tasks flag added, with varying
amounts of nthreads. This test is able to reproduce a panic which was
caught manually during development [1]; in the current version of this
patch set, it passes.
Note that this commit also makes all stress tests using the
run_io_and_remove helper more stressful by additionally exercising the
batch submit (queue_rqs) path.
